Auburn Hospital provides a comprehensive range of clinical services for a culturally diverse population, with 67 percent of our patients coming from a non-English speaking background. Including English, our staff can speak a staggering 70 languages. Auburn Hospital is a major teaching facility with the University of Notre Dame Australia.
